The extension of the deadline for single-family homes, which had carried out at least 30% of the work by 30 September last, could go as far as 30 September, to conclude the expense and deduct it, benefiting from 110%.
The extension until 30 June is contained in an amendment to the superbonus decree which has a favorable opinion but the government has reserved itself on a series of other amendments which will arrive until 30 September and which it is not excluded that they may have a green light when at 13 the House Finance Committee will meet again.
A solution on the release of the transfers of superbonus credits relating to the expenses of 2022 could arrive during the day:
the hypothesis circulating in these hours is that of postponing the deadline from 31 March to 30 November for the presentation of the relative communication to the Revenue Agency with a fine of 250 euros.
During the meeting of the House Finance Committee, where the provision is being discussed, an amendment on the matter was in fact announced.
In the meantime, a package of 8 reformulations from the government arrived in the morning on the issues on which mediation was found yesterday: from the earthquake bonus to free building to the guaranteed discount and transfer for Iacp, non-profit organizations and architectural barriers.
Still under study, however, the issue of the release of problem loans.
